Add data labels Click the chart, and then click the Chart Design tab. Click Add Chart Element and select Data Labels, and then select a location for the data label option. Note: The options will differ depending on your chart type. If you want to show your data label inside a text bubble shape, click Data Callout.
Adding the custom labels to the data series Use the chart skittle (the + sign to the right of the chart) to select Data Labels and select More Options to display the Data Labels task pane. Check the Value From Cells checkbox and select the cells containing the custom labels, cells C5 to C16 in this example.
In the worksheet, click the cell that contains the title or data label text that you want to change. Edit the existing contents, or type the new text or value, and then press ENTER. The changes you made automatically appear on the chart.
Edit pivot chart data labels Select the pivot chart you want to edit. , tap Style, then tap Labels. Tap Pivot Data Labels, then choose the names you want to show, or choose Hide All Names. Note: The options you see in Pivot Data Labels may change based on the fields in the pivot table.
To begin renaming your data series, select one from the list and then click the Edit button. In the Edit Series box, you can begin to rename your data series labels. By default, Excel will use the column or row label, using the cell reference to determine this.

To move the elements inside the chart with the arrow keys: Select the element in the chart you want to move (title, data labels, legend, plot area). On the add-in window press the Move Selected Object with Arrow Keys button. Press any of the arrow keys on the keyboard to move the chart element.
To reposition a series of data labels: Select the series of data labels by clicking on one of the labels. Choose the Format Data Labels menu option and click the Options tab. In the Position frame, choose a positioning option for the data labels. Click Apply or OK to see your changes.
Modify axis labels Tap the chart, then tap . Tap Style, then tap Labels. Do any of the following: Modify markings on the Value (Y) axis: Tap Value Labels under Value (Y) Axis. Use the controls to make any adjustments. If you turn on Axis Name, Numbers adds a placeholder axis name to the chart.
